Kermit Crafts: A Neck Bunting and Eye Barrettes November 17, 2011 By radmegan 15 Comments I've been thinking a LOT about the new Muppet Movie lately... When I'm going to go see it, who I'll be going with, and WHAT I'm going to wear. After … [Read more...]